XL Group announced it plans to hold its seventh Global Day of Giving on Friday, May 4. The employee volunteer day is dedicated to supporting the communities in which XL operates.
From its beginning in 2006, the Global Day of Giving has grown with employees donating more than 100,000 hours of community service to hundreds of charitable projects in various locations worldwide.
“As countries and communities around the world are facing some of the toughest times in recent history, it is imperative that global companies like XL join forces with charities and other non-profit organizations to not only come up with sustainable solutions but to physically lend a helping hand. Over the years, XL’s Global Day of Giving has enabled us to strengthen our relationships within communities where we work,” said Mike McGavick, the company’s CEO.
More than 150 projects have been scheduled to address major issues including disaster relief, education, environment, homelessness, hunger and senior care.
